Local Laws Overview
In Brcko, speed limits and traffic regulations are established by both local and national authorities. Drivers must adhere to posted speed limits, which vary in urban and rural areas. The use of seat belts is mandatory, and driving under the influence of alcohol or drugs is strictly prohibited. Traffic lights and signs must be obeyed without exception. Violation of these laws can result in fines, the accumulation of demerit points, and in severe cases, suspension of driving privileges. Additionally, the use of mobile phones without hands-free devices while driving is illegal.
Frequently Asked Questions
What are the general speed limits in Brcko?
In urban areas, the speed limit is typically 50 km/h, while on rural roads it can be 80 km/h unless otherwise indicated. On highways, the limit usually increases to 120 km/h.
How are traffic fines determined?
Traffic fines are generally based on the severity of the offense. They can range from mild financial penalties for minor infractions to more substantial fines or legal actions for serious violations.
What should I do if I receive a speeding ticket?
Review the ticket for accuracy. If you believe the ticket was unjust, you have the right to contest it in court. It might be beneficial to consult with a lawyer to understand the best course of action.
Can speeding tickets affect my driving record?
Yes, speeding tickets can add demerit points to your driving record, which may affect your driving privileges and increase insurance premiums.
Do I have to pay the fine immediately?
Not necessarily. You typically have a specific period to pay the fine or contest the ticket. It's important to respond within the given timeframe to avoid additional penalties.
Is there a way to reduce the penalty for a traffic offense?
In some cases, attending a traffic school or other measures may help reduce penalties. A lawyer can provide advice on possible options based on your situation.
Can I get a speeding ticket dismissed?
If there are errors on the ticket or if the method of determining your speed was faulty, you might have grounds for dismissal. Legal assistance can help in exploring such possibilities.
How does a DUI charge differ from a speeding ticket?
A DUI is considered a more serious offense and carries heavier penalties, including higher fines, possible imprisonment, and longer license suspensions compared to a speeding ticket.
What happens if I ignore a traffic ticket?
Ignoring a traffic ticket can lead to more severe consequences, such as increased fines, legal action, and even a warrant for your arrest. It is crucial to address the ticket promptly.
Where can I find more information on traffic laws?
The local police department and municipal court have information on traffic laws. Websites managed by governmental bodies often provide comprehensive guidelines and legal texts.
